For the record, since this is Arnies and not Zero In itself, I thought the following may be of some use to you guys:

 

- 20 days left to book

- more stuff added to the extended menu from last year, like doughnuts and fajitas

- extra freebies in welcome packs

- 750 players signed up so far

- pistol/shotgun game arranged for Friday

- the Somerley Beer Festival runs on the same weekend adjacent to the site for added entertainment in the evenings

there's a couple of "village" setups, but they are all just a small group of basic wooden huts. not really a CQB proposition. I reckon with more than four people in it it would just be like a circular firing squad.

"The Fort" is pretty CQB, although again not a huge amount of room for any serious numbers before it would turn into an absolute mess game wise.

 

Also, from what they've been saying, they're trying to hold the pistol games off the main site, so that they don't interfear with the main game.
